In today's hyperconnected world, every digital interaction generates a trace. These traces, known as digital footprints or cyber clues, can shed light on a wealth of information about an individual's online activities, behaviors, and even identities. Digital forensics is the specialized field that utilizes these traces to extract evidence for legal, investigative, or operational purposes. It's a meticulous process demanding a deep understanding of both technological and investigative concepts.

Forensic Toxicology: Unveiling the Hidden Clues
In the intricate world of criminal investigations, where evidence can be subtle and often invisible to the naked eye, toxicology emerges as a crucial discipline. Forensic toxicologists act as scientific detectives, meticulously analyzing biological samples including blood, urine, and tissue for the presence of drugs, poisons, or other harmful substances. These analyses provide invaluable insights into a crime's occurrence, helping to establish whether a suspect was under the influence of intoxicating substances at the time of the alleged offense. Toxicology plays a vital role in clarifying complex cases, providing objective evidence that can either exonerate individuals and contribute to achieving justice.
- Furthermore,toxicological investigations can help determine the cause of death in suspicious circumstances. By identifying the presence and concentration of toxins in a victim's body, forensic toxicologists can reveal whether was caused by poisoning or another form of drug-related harm.
- Qualified testimony from toxicological experts plays a crucial role in court proceedings, helping juries understand the complex scientific findings and their relevance to the case at hand.

The World of Forensics: From Fingerprint Analysis to DNA Profiling
The world of forensics offers an intriguing field where science meets investigation. From the ancient practice of fingerprint analysis to the modern marvel of DNA profiling, forensic experts utilize a vast array of techniques to expose the truth behind suspicious activities. Fingerprint analysis, a cornerstone of forensics, relies on the unique patterns found on every human's fingertips to connect suspects with crime scenes. DNA profiling, on the other hand, analyzes an individual's genetic code to establish relationships. This revolutionary technology has transformed the landscape of forensic investigations, providing essential evidence in countless cases.
